How to Split PDF Files:
- Upload PDF: Select your PDF file (up to 50MB)
- Choose Method: Select how you want to split the PDF
- Configure Settings: Define page ranges or split options
- Preview: Check the split preview before processing
- Split: Click "Split PDF Now" button
- Download: Save split files individually or as ZIP
